The Saunaka rugby 7s team received a major boost in their preparation for his weekend’s Fiji Bitter Nawaka Sevens tournament at Prince Charles Park, Nadi. The Nadi based- side received $10,000 sponsorship yesterday from McDonald’s Fiji.
McDonald’s Fiji managing director Marc McElrath said the ongoing sponsorship was a commitment from McDonald’s to give back to the sport of sevens rugby in Nadi.
“The new sponsorship agreement of $10,000 will be for another 12 months and will also include kaji rugby and netball teams as well,” he said.
“Its part of the commitment as McDonald’s has been supporting Saunaka rugby for the last five years and this new agreement will further the relationship into the future.”
Saunaka Rugby 7s sponsorship chairman Ponijese Raiyasi said the assistance would help the team in their preparation for the Nawaka Sevens.
“This sponsorship means a lot to Saunaka, our partnership with McDonald’s has helped our boys prepare for all the tournaments in Fiji,” he said.
“We are looking forward to the Nawaka sevens this weekend and we hope to do our best for our sponsors.”
He said the team would remain as McDonald’s Saunaka in all competitions they play in this season.
They are led by Atama Susu, plucky playmaker Sela Toga, Livai Saukuru, and Josaia Roko.
Saunaka is the home of Fiji Airways Fijian 7s utility backs and Olympians Vatemo Ravouvou and Kitione Taliga.
In the past decades Saunaka Rugby has produced top players like Sela Toga (Snr), Ratu Josateki Sovau, Nasivi Ravouvou, Ilaitia Ravouvou, Apisai Toga and the list goes on.
